Caption: Children from Bradford-Tioga Head Start Mansfield PM classroom pose with their new teddy bears. Nora Gridley donated the bears as a part of the classroom’s week-long study of bears.

MANSFIELD, PA—As a part of their week-long study of bears, the children of the Bradford-Tioga Head Start’s Mansfield PM classroom participated in a “Teddy Bear” school project. All of the children received a teddy bear from Nora Gridley, the mother of their classroom teacher aide Stacy. 

During the week, these teddy bears were taken on a “bear hunt” where the children utilized their handmade binoculars. The week closed with the children taking part in a special “Teddy Bear Picnic” lunch in tribute to the famous song of the same name. 

Bradford-Tioga Head Start, a Laurel Health System program, offers state and federally funded programs for children, ages newborn up to the age of 5, pregnant mothers, and families. For more information, call 1-800-808-5287, Extension 400.
